Agnes VanDyke

VanDyke

Agnes E. VanDyke, 96, of Butler, formerly of Prospect, died Saturday evening Dec. 30, 2023, at Concordia At The Orchard in Butler.

Agnes was born in Butler, on June 24, 1927, and was the daughter of Carl and Bertha Dietrich Angerett. She was Presbyterian by faith and she loved her grandchildren.

Survivors include two daughters, Lola Hoffman of Butler and Deborah (Terry) McCormick of Renfrew; three stepchildren; two sisters, Velma Bauer and Linda (Tom) Woodhead; four grandchildren; and six great-grandchildren.

Agnes was preceded in death by two husbands; two brothers; two sisters; one grandson; and one brother-in-law.

The family would like to thank Concordia at the Orchard for their excellent care of Agnes.

VANDYKE — As per her wishes, a private family visitation for Agnes E. VanDyke, who died Saturday Dec. 30, 2023, was held on Thursday at JAY BRYAN FUNERAL HOME, Prospect. A funeral service followed with the Rev. James Lewis officiating. Burial took place Friday at the Greenlawn Burial Estates and Mausoleum in Butler.
